Subject: Cut-over complete — Brindlewood schema migration

Hello plugin authors,

The Brindlewood platform finished its zero-downtime schema migration last night. We used an expand-contract approach: new columns were added, dual writes ran for 48 hours, and legacy columns were dropped this morning. No API contract changes affect published plugins, but anyone querying the registry tables directly should update to the v9 views. Dual-write shims remain active for one more week. The migration runner executed with the following configuration values.

config for fajep-bajeg:
WENIX_HOST=wenix.qorvelsys.internal
WENIX_PORT=8000

Handover on the Bramblebox image slimming work: we moved the base to a distroless variant and multi-stage builds, cutting the runtime image from 1.2GB to about 180MB. Gotchas for whoever inherits this — the debug tools are gone, so use the sidecar shell image; and the healthcheck binary must be statically linked or it silently fails. Remaining task: trim the ML worker image the same way. Ownership of the build pipeline now sits with the engineer named below.

named custodian: Quenael Briax

**Management Meeting Minutes — Quillbrook Systems**

Attendees: Farrah, Denholm, Oska. We agreed the legacy-customer price increase goes ahead next quarter — roughly 8%, phased over two billing cycles. Comms to be softened with a loyalty credit. Denholm flagged churn risk in the Westmere accounts; we'll monitor. The board should read the confidential plan summarised below.

board note of yahig-baguf: The renewal with Ralwynek Holdings closes at $20 million a year, 20 percent above the last contract. Project Druix slips by two quarters because of the staffing delay.

**Alert: Consent banner rollout — plugin compatibility**

The Quillbrook platform is rolling out a new consent banner across all hosted storefronts starting next release cycle. Plugins that inject scripts before consent is recorded will be blocked from loading. Plugin authors should verify their integrations use the deferred-load hook introduced in SDK version 4. Rollout schedule, affected regions, and migration notes are published on the page below.

wiki page, tahaf-tajog: https://jira.ordindyn.corp/pipeline